'It was a special moment': James Milner struggles to hold back emotions after final Liverpool game

Liverpool stalwart James Milner bid farewell to Anfield in his last match for the club, marking the end of a remarkable career with the Reds. He couldn't hold back his emotions after receiving a guard of honour.

The 37-year-old was brought on with 20 minutes to go in the 1-1 draw against Aston Villa to a raucous reception by the Anfield faithful.

He told BBC Sport after the match: "It was a special moment. I've been lucky to have a pretty good time here. It is a special place, I might play here again, who knows.The trophy Liverpool always wanted was the league title and to leave after eight years and have done that, it's what you hope happens.

"I've had an unbelievable time here. I'm content. Happy with the job and the team I've been a part of and the success we've contributed to the club's history.

"One more game to go, it would be nice to finish with a win. I've been available most of the year, I've contributed and I still feel good. Age is just a number."
